IGP Baba deploys four police commissioners to Delta for Saturday elections

The inspector general of police, Alkali Usman, has directed the deployment of four Commissioners of Police to Delta on election duty.

The inspector general of police, Alkali Usman, has directed the deployment of four Commissioners of Police to Delta on election duty.

Police spokesman Bright Edafe announced the directive in a statement in Asaba on Friday.

The statement said the deployment was to ensure effective policing and adequate security during the general elections in Delta.

Police commissioner John Babangida will be in charge of the election in Delta, while police commissioner Mamman Sanda will handle Delta-North.

It said police commissioner Zachariah Fera would be in charge of Delta-South while police commissioner Adebola Hamzat would take charge of Delta-Central.

According to the statement, the police will work with sister security agencies to provide adequate security at polling units, collation centres and INEC offices in Delta.

It stated that Marine Police were deployed to secure the waterways to ensure the free movement of voting materials, officials and the electorate.

The officer restated the ban on vehicular movement between 12:00 a.m. to 6:00 p.m. on election day.

”Only officials on emergency and essential duties will be allowed passage during this period. The ban on security escorts for politicians during the election still stands, (and) politicians are advised not to move with their security details on election day,” added the statement.

The police statement also mentioned that vigilance groups and anti-cult volunteers would not be allowed to play any security roles during the elections, urging the electorate to be law-abiding and to conduct themselves in a manner that would promote free and credible elections.
